.navbar{position:fixed;top:0;left:0;right:0;background:#000;padding:15px 30px;display:flex;justify-content:space-between;align-items:center;border-bottom:1px solid silver;z-index:100}.logo{color:silver;font-size:1.5rem;font-weight:700}.nav-links{display:flex;gap:8px;justify-content:center;flex:1;margin:0 20px}.nav-links a{color:silver;text-decoration:none;font-size:1rem;padding:8px 16px;border:1px solid silver;border-radius:10px;transition:all .3s;white-space:nowrap}.nav-links a:hover{background:silver;color:#000}.nav-right{display:flex;align-items:center;gap:15px}.menu-btn{display:none;background:none;border:1px solid silver;border-radius:8px;color:silver;font-size:19px;cursor:pointer;padding:4px 10px}.user-circle{width:40px;height:40px;border-radius:50%;border:1px solid silver;overflow:hidden;cursor:pointer;flex-shrink:0}.user-avatar{width:100%;height:100%;object-fit:cover}@media (max-width: 768px){.navbar{padding:12px 20px}.logo{font-size:1.2rem}.nav-links{display:none}.menu-btn{display:block}.user-circle{width:35px;height:35px}}.mobile-menu{position:fixed;top:0;right:-100%;width:80%;max-width:350px;height:100vh;background:#0f0f0f;z-index:1000;transition:right .3s ease-in-out;box-shadow:-5px 0 25px #00000080}.mobile-menu.active{right:0}.mobile-menu-header{display:flex;justify-content:space-between;align-items:center;padding:20px;border-bottom:1px solid silver;background:#000}.mobile-menu-header .logo{font-size:1.2rem}.close-btn{background:none;border:1px solid silver;border-radius:50%;width:35px;height:35px;color:silver;font-size:20px;cursor:pointer;display:flex;align-items:center;justify-content:center}.mobile-menu-items{display:flex;flex-direction:column;padding:20px;gap:15px}.mobile-menu-items a{color:silver;text-decoration:none;font-size:1.1rem;padding:12px 15px;border-radius:10px;transition:all .3s;display:flex;align-items:center;gap:12px;border:1px solid silver}.mobile-menu-items a:hover{background:silver;color:#000}.mobile-menu-items a span{font-size:1.3rem}.mobile-menu.active:before{content:"";position:fixed;top:0;left:0;right:0;bottom:0;background:#000000b3;z-index:-1}@media (max-width: 480px){.mobile-menu{width:100%;max-width:100%}.logo{font-size:1rem}.user-circle{width:30px;height:30px}}.nav-links a.active,.mobile-menu-items a.active{background:silver;color:#000;border-color:silver}.mobile-menu-items a.active span{color:#000}
